CHS 356 - Vulnerable Populations (Cross-listed as NRS 356)


Units: 3
Three hours lecture per week
Assists the learner to evaluate multicultural (including Chicana/o, Latina/o and other communities of color in the U.S) and psychosocial factors that create vulnerable populations and understand health care issues resulting from vulnerability. Presents concepts of vulnerable populations: health indicators, health determinants, and health disparities. Explores vulnerable populations from global, national, and local perspectives. Implications for research, practice and policy are examined.
Graded: Letter Grade
Same as: NRS 356
GenEd: D
